How Our Document Drying Services Actually Work

When water damage affects your documents, every minute counts. Our team springs into action, using specialized equipment to dry and restore your documents to their original condition. We’ll extract water, dry the area, and clean and dehumidify your documents to prevent further damage. Our process is meticulous, and our technicians are trained to handle even the most delicate items.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We begin by inspecting the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. This helps us create a customized plan to restore your documents. Our teams are equipped with mo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den water dam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use specialized equipment, such as wet/dry vacuums and truck-mounted extractors, to remove water from the affected area.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the area and remove excess moisture from the air and surfaces. This helps prevent further damage and promotes a healthy environment.

Step 4: Cleaning and Restoration

Once the area is dry, we clean and restore your documents to their original condition. This involves gently cleaning and sanitizing the documents, as well as using specialized equipment to restore their original texture and appearance.

Step 5: Monitoring and Quality Control

Finally, we monitor the area to ensure that the moisture levels are within a safe range. We also conduct quality control checks to ensure that your documents are restored to their original condition.

How can I prevent water damage from affecting my documents?

To prevent water damage from affecting your documents, consider using waterproof containers or storage bins, keeping your documents in a dry and secure location, and monitoring your home for signs of water damage or leaks. It’s also essential to regularly inspect your documents for signs of damage or deterioration.
